St. Petersburg is a great city with some amazing restaurants and bars. Going out can get a little expensive though sometimes, so St. Pete happy hour is always a beautiful thing. Here are some awesome happy hours on the other side of the bay.
St. Pete Happy Hour Spots
Beach Drive – St. Pete Happy Hour
Birchwood Canopy Rooftop
Enjoy rooftop views and great prices at the Birchwood Canopy weekdays from 4-7pm. Signature drinks and select wines by the glass are half off and select beers are only $3. This is a great happy hour spot in St. Pete to sip and soak in the sunset.
400 Beach Seafood & Taphouse
Dubbed “A Very Happy Hour,” 400 Beach has a stacked St. Pete happy hour menu with discounts on apps and burgers, as well as $8 cocktails & house wines and half price sparkling wines.
Stillwaters Tavern
$1 off draft beers, select wines on tap for $7.49, bubbles for $5 – there’s a little something for everyone at Stillwaters. Enjoy their generous happy hour daily from open until 7pm.
Sea Salt
In the bar and lounge area of Sea Salt St. Pete from 3-6pm all wine by the glass, draft beer, wells, calls, and liquors are 50% off. This happy hour happens every day. On Tuesday, happy hour runs long from 4pm to close with 50% off all bottles of wine that are under $100. The happy hour menu also includes reduced prices on a selection of apps and sandwiches.

Bella Brava
Bella Brava St. Pete has an all-day happy hour that ends at 7pm and is every single day. These happy hour deals include $3 wells, $3 craft beer, and sangria for $4.79.
The sangria is a personal favorite, but with deals this good, feel free to try them all. Bella Brava Tampa also opened this year and offers the same great happy hour.
Grand Central District
Casita Taqueria
St. Pete happy hour with tacos on top – Casita Taqueria offers happy hour Monday – Thursday from 4 – 6pm. Tacos for just $2, $3 margs and sangria and $2 tecates make it a great casual spot to grab dinner and drinks.
The Studio Public House
Not only does The Studio Public House have a great vibe for art lovers, they feature happy hour from 3pm to close Monday and Wednesday and 3-6pm Thursday and Friday. Select beers are $3 and house wines are $4. Spend your time sipping away and perusing works for sale from local artists.
The Edge District
COPA Wine and Tapas
We love the ambiance at Copa and they’ve got great specials every weeknight. Happy hour is 5 – 7pm with half off classic cocktails. They also have specials like $4 tacos and $7 craft margaritas on Tuesdays and two for one wines for wine down Wednesdays.

Hawkers
Monday through Friday, 3-6pm, stop by Hawkers for some great St. Pete happy hour specials. Select bites and house wines are just $4, $4 off specialty cocktails and $3 Asian lagers and sake bombs.
Intermezzo
Intermezzo is a delightful little coffee and cocktail spot (service for both begins at 8 a.m). Stop in for a St. Pete happy hour between 5 an 7pm and enjoy $6 Reissdorf Kolsch, $3 High Life and $7 wine and cocktails.
Central Arts District — St. Pete Happy Hour
The Avenue
The Avenue is an awesome spot for a St. Pete happy hour. Monday through Friday from 4pm to 7pm all wells, wines, and drafts are $4. Specialty cocktails during this time are only $7, so head on over for an after work drink. You can enjoy half off bites and sharables, as well, if you want to knock out dinner, too.
Central Avenue Oyster Bar
Happy hour at this seafood spot is every day from 3 – 6pm. You can’t beat $1 Gulf oysters, especially when you can enjoy them with $5 drafts, house wines and old fashions. If you’re up for it, oyster shooters are $1 each, as well.
Crafty Squirrel
The Crafty Squirrel has one of the most straightforward happy hours in town. Buy a drink from 3 – 6pm Monday through Friday and the second one is free. Liquor, wine, beer, really anything but teapots, your second of the same drink is on the house.
